Course Outline
Introduction to Data Protection
- Comprehending the necessity of backup and recovery.
- Overview of backup types and retention models.
- Common challenges in implementing backup strategies.
Overview of Veritas Backup Exec
- Product architecture and core components.
- Supported platforms and workloads.
- Considerations for licensing and installation.
Installation and Configuration
- System preparation for installation.
- Deploying the Backup Exec server and agents.
- Initial setup and licensing procedures.
Storage and Device Management
- Adding storage devices and defining media sets.
- Configuring disk, tape, and cloud storage options.
- Managing the lifecycle of storage assets.
Creation of Backup Jobs
- Establishing backup jobs for various workloads.
- Setting up schedules and automation.
- Monitoring and validating backup operations.
Data Recovery and Restore Operations
- Restoring files, folders, and virtual machines.
- Utilizing granular recovery options.
- Handling disaster recovery scenarios.
Monitoring, Reporting, and Maintenance
- Utilizing logs and alerts.
- Generating reports.
- Maintaining the backup environment.
Summary and Next Steps
Requirements
- Familiarity with data backup concepts.
- Hands-on experience in Windows Server administration.
- Basic knowledge of IT infrastructure tools.
Target Audience
- System administrators tasked with backup operations.
- IT infrastructure professionals.
- Technical support personnel overseeing server environments.
